Lummis Unveils CLARITY Bill to Tackle Cryptocurrency Crimes

Share

Senator Lummis has introduced a new bill called CLARITY, aimed at combating cryptocurrency-related crimes. The legislation targets groups like the Lazarus Group, which have been linked to various illicit activities.

The CLARITY act is part of a broader effort to regulate and protect the crypto space from bad actors. By addressing issues like money laundering and terrorist financing, lawmakers hope to increase trust in digital assets and promote their adoption.

As the cryptocurrency industry continues to grow, concerns about its security and legitimacy have intensified. The CLARITY bill is a step towards mitigating these risks and ensuring that crypto is used for its intended purpose: to facilitate secure and transparent financial transactions.
